In 1958, Chevrolet re-named the light-duty trucks to Apaches. The medium-duty trucks were called Vikings and the heavy-duty trucks were called Spartans. Design changes included four headlights instead of the previous two. There were given a shorter and wider grille which ran the width of the front end. Parking lights were now located in the grille instead of being in the front of the fender. The Fleetside Pickup box was introduced mid-year of 1958.
